编程零基础学 编程零基础学难吗
网络编程 2024-09-25 06:42www.168986.cn编程入门
在这个数字化迅速发展的时代,编程已经成为了一项必备技能。无论你是希望转行进入IT行业,还是想在现有工作中提升效率,甚至仅仅是为了兴趣学习,编程都能为你打开全新的大门。许多人在面对“编程”这个词时,常常会感到畏惧或无从下手。尤其是对于那些没有任何编程基础的人而言,学习编程似乎是一件遥不可及的事情。但实际上,无论你有多少经验,编程都是可以循序渐进掌握的技能。
编程是如何从零开始的?
编程的核心并非高深莫测的技术,而是逻辑思维的训练。编程语言不过是表达这种逻辑的工具。因此,即便你没有计算机背景,也不必担心。你所需要的是一颗好奇心,以及一步步学习的耐心。
开始编程学习的第一步,是理解编程的基本概念。编程语言有很多种,如Python、JavaScript、Java等,但它们的基本逻辑相似。举例来说,几乎所有编程语言都涉及变量、数据类型、条件判断、循环语句等概念。理解这些基础概念是编程的第一步,也是最重要的一步。
选择适合零基础的编程语言
对于零基础学习者来说,选择一种容易上手的编程语言非常重要。Python是目前最流行的入门编程语言之一。它具有简单易读的语法,非常适合初学者学习。Python有广泛的应用范围,从数据分析到人工智能,从Web开发到自动化任务,都可以使用Python实现。
如何制定学习计划?
编程是一项技能,和学习任何技能一样,制定一个合理的学习计划是至关重要的。对于零基础的学习者,建议每天花费1-2小时进行编程练习,而不是试图一次性学习大量内容。持续的学习和实践能让你更快掌握编程技巧。
一个典型的学习计划可以分为以下几个阶段:
入门阶段(1-2周):熟悉编程环境,了解基本语法,掌握变量和数据类型。
基础阶段(3-4周):深入学习条件判断、循环结构和函数,理解代码的逻辑结构。
实战阶段(4-6周):通过小项目练习编程技能,如创建简单的计算器、制作小型游戏等。
提升阶段(7-10周):学习数据结构与算法,提高代码的效率和复杂性。
在这个过程中,不要害怕犯错。编程是一门需要反复试验的学问,错误是学习过程中最好的老师。通过调试和修改代码,你将逐渐理解编程的逻辑,提升自己的编程能力。
利用在线资源与社区支持
现代学习者有一个巨大的优势,那就是互联网提供了丰富的学习资源和支持社区。无论是免费的在线教程、视频课程,还是各类编程论坛和讨论区,都可以为你的学习之路提供帮助。尤其是像StackOverflow这样的编程问答社区,不仅能帮你解决具体的问题,还能让你学到更多的编程技巧和实践经验。
打好基础,未来无可限量
掌握编程基础后,你就可以根据自己的兴趣和职业规划,深入学习某个特定领域。比如,你可以学习Web开发,制作自己的网站或应用程序;或者学习数据科学,通过分析数据发现新的商业机会。编程的应用几乎无处不在,而一旦掌握了这门技能,未来的职业发展将拥有无限可能。
项目驱动:从实践中提升编程能力
学习编程并不是仅仅理解理论概念,更重要的是通过实践不断提高。项目驱动学习是一种非常有效的方法。通过实际项目的开发,你不仅能加深对编程概念的理解,还能培养解决问题的能力。
对于初学者来说,项目的选择不必太复杂。一开始,你可以从简单的小项目入手,比如制作一个基础的个人网站、开发一个简单的计算器应用,或者编写一个可以处理文件的小程序。这些项目看似简单,但它们涵盖了编程中的许多重要概念,如用户输入、数据处理、逻辑判断等。
随着你对编程的掌握逐渐加深,可以尝试更为复杂的项目,如开发一个任务管理工具、创建一个数据分析平台,甚至尝试制作一个简单的游戏。这些项目不仅能让你学到更多的编程技巧,还能为你未来的职业发展积累实际经验。
如何保持学习动力?
在学习编程的过程中,保持动力是一个不小的挑战。尤其是当你遇到困难时,很容易感到挫败,从而失去继续学习的兴趣。为了保持学习的动力,你可以采取以下几种策略:
设立短期目标:将学习目标拆分成更小、更可实现的部分。每次完成一个小目标,都能给你带来成就感,增强学习动力。
加入学习社区:与其他学习者交流经验、分享心得。通过社区互动,你不仅可以获得他人的鼓励,还能学到新的学习方法和技巧。
记录学习过程:无论是通过客记录每日学习心得,还是通过笔记总结学习内容,记录过程能帮助你回顾和反思自己的学习历程。
奖励自己:当你达成了某个阶段性的目标时,不妨给自己一些奖励,比如购买一本新的编程书籍,或者体验一款自己喜欢的游戏,这样的小奖励能帮助你保持学习的积极性。
避免常见的学习误区
在学习编程的过程中,初学者常常会陷入一些误区。不要过分依赖教程和视频。虽然这些资源非常有用,但编程本质上是实践性的,光看不练是无法真正掌握的。不要急于求成。编程是一个循序渐进的过程,尝试跳过基础直接进入高级内容只会让你感到更加困惑。
另一个常见误区是畏惧错误。编程中,错误是常态,甚至可以说是学习的一部分。每次debug都是一次学习机会,通过解决问题,你将不断加深对编程的理解。所以,当遇到问题时,不要气馁,耐心分析,找出问题的根源并解决它。
持续学习,成就无限可能
编程是一项需要持续学习的技能。随着技术的发展,新语言、新框架、新工具层出不穷,这意味着编程学习是一个没有终点的旅程。正是这种不断挑战自我、不断进步的过程,使得编程成为一种令人兴奋且充满成就感的技能。
对于零基础的学习者来说,迈出第一步是最重要的。一旦你掌握了基础,你将发现,编程不仅是一项有用的技能,更是一扇通往更广阔世界的门。无论你是为了职业发展,还是为了提升个人能力,学习编程都将为你带来意想不到的收获。
所以,不要再犹豫,现在就开始你的编程之旅吧!用耐心与毅力,将代码变成你手中的魔法,创造出属于你的数字奇迹。
这篇软文旨在为零基础学习者提供一份全面的编程入门指南,同时激励他们积极探索编程世界的无限可能。无论你是为了职业发展,还是纯粹为了兴趣,这篇文章将为你指明前进的方向。
编程语言
- 代码编程软件 代码编程软件电脑版下载
- 编程零基础学 编程零基础学难吗
- python培训班哪个靠谱 十大少儿编程教育品牌
- 儿童编程课哪个最好 儿童编程课推荐
- 编程语言排行榜2024 编程语言排行榜8月
- java 编程,java编程和python编程
- 儿童编程教学入门教程 儿童编程免费教程
- 代码编程教学入门视频 代码编程步骤
- 孩子学编程最佳年龄 孩子学编程最佳年龄初中可
- 儿童学编程到底好不好 儿童学编程有用吗学了好
- 初学编程应该先学什么 初次学编程应该学什么
- 成人编程培训机构排名前十 国内java培训最好的机
- 编程公司:编程公司对年龄要求高吗
- java零基础自学 java零基础自学视频
- 初学编程怎么开始 初学编程怎么学
- 编程软件排行 编程语言排行榜